			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a id="imageViewerLink" href="http://astore.amazon.com/motley-health-fitness-store-20/detail/B000MIXWJG"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-1171 alignright" title="saw horse" src="http://www.motleyhealth.com/fitness_and_strength/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/saw-horse-150x150.jpg" alt="Saw horse for weight lifting squat and bench press support" width="150" height="150" /></a>If you are planning to set up a weights gym at home, safety is one of the most important considerations. Few people can afford multi-gyms large enough to allow you to perform all the exercises needed to workout your whole body.  <a href="http://www.motleyhealth.com/fitness_and_strength/product-reviews/power-rack-reviews-powerline-titan-tds-deltech-fitness-best-fitness">Power racks (aka power cages) </a>are the best option if you are lifting free weights, however not everyone has the space or money to buy a good rack. So, what do you do?  The answer is simple &#8211; saw horses. Many people use saw horses to support their barbell. They can handle a huge amount of weight, are adjustable, and often lightweight and can be folded up and stored away.</p>

<p>Saw horses are a builders / woodworkers tool. They are lightweight (used to be made from wood, but now plastic/metals) and can support a huge weight. For example, the <a href="http://astore.amazon.com/motley-health-fitness-store-20/detail/B000MIXWJG">Stanley 60622 Folding Adjustable Sawhorse</a> can support up to 1000 pounds (450kg) so is plenty for any weight lifter to train with. You can position them for bench press and squats (the two most popular big compound exercises) so that you do not find yourself pinned to a bench or the floor!  Saw horses are limited as they are not always height adjustable, and when they are the range is small. But for safety when squatting they are very useful.  We recommend a 7 foot bar because these provide much greater stability. You can have the supports (saw horse) set further apart, and there is much less chance of the bar tipping when changing weights over. Also, if you decide to upgrade your home gym and buy a <a href="http://www.motleyhealth.com/fitness_and_strength/product-reviews/power-rack-reviews-powerline-titan-tds-deltech-fitness-best-fitness">power cage</a>, you will need to the longer bar. But the main reason is safety.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://astore.amazon.com/motley-health-fitness-store-20/detail/0897501705">Bruce Lee&#8217;s Fighting Method</a> is an excellent illustration of the various techniques and skills that Bruce Lee mastered. Originally this was released as a series of books, but now it is available in one handy volume. It also features updated photographs, a new chapter written by Ted Wong (one of Bruce&#8217;s students) and a new introduction by Lee&#8217;s daughter, Shannon Lee.</p>
<p>Bruce Lee was a legendary martial artist, both on screen and off. Unlike many martial artists that appear on screen today, his was a trained fighter, not just a choreographer. He believed in removing form from martial arts, and to use any techniques that worked, and this is the basis of his method, Jeet Kune Do. This book covers all aspects of journey, from his martial arts workouts, his complimentary weight training, research, and his philosophy.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>For serious free weight training a Power Rack (or Power Cage) is essential, especially if you are training without a spotter. A Power Rack / Cage surrounds your weight lifting bench, and provide solid horizontal supports that can hold a fully loaded barbell. This allows you to squat, bench press or shoulder press with confidence, as failure does not mean injury. Power racks also allow modification of movement, and aid lifting. For example, if doing bent over rows with a heavy var, you can use the power rack to support the bar in the start position, to save lifting from the ground. They also come with attachments to allow dips and lateral pull downs.</p>
<p>There are several respectable brands on the market selling power racks. All racks are built to a very good quality, and all can carry a very heavy weight, certainly more than the average home bodybuilder requires.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Denise Austin has a growing selection of fitness DVD&#8217;s on the market. She is an American fitness instructor, writes for mainstream media and is a member of the President&#8217;s Council on Physical Fitness and Sports. She started her career in fitness as a child when she excelled in gymnastics which led to her accepting an athletic scholarship at the University of Arizona. After studying in Arizona she moved to California State University, and was awarded  degree in Physical Education and Exercise Physiology.</p>
<p>Austin is a firm believer in natural health and fitness. She believes that you only need to exercise for 30 minutes a day, and should eat 3 meals a day. She also uses of sugar and butter instead artificial sweeteners and margarine, as controlling portion size is the key to maintaining a healthy weight.</p>
<p>Austin advocates fitness for all ages, and collaborates with researchers in nutrition, to emphasize realistic, real-life solutions to weight control and fitness. Austin supports a balanced program of exercise and proper diet, and encourages people to stay away from fad diets or &#8220;crazy claims&#8221; for quick fixes. Her exercise programs often integrate a variety of methods including yoga, Pilates, cross training, and aerobic exercise.</p>

<h3>In the beginning</h3>
<p>Joe Weider was born in Montreal, Quebec in 1922. He grew up in a rough neighborhood where walking home from school was a dangerous activity for a thin young boy. Joe and his brother Ben started to look for ways to build up strength and increase their body size to be able to defend themselves against the neighborhood bullies. They turned to fitness magazines of the time and tried several of the programs to no avail.</p>
<p>One day they happened to be in a scrap yard and noticed some old axles and wheels that they quickly converted into barbells. Joe and Ben Weider decided to start using these weights to train to increase their strength. Joe soon noticed that he did begin to feel physically stronger when working out with the home-made barbells. His arms and legs became larger and more powerful and along with them, his self-confidence.</p>
<h3>Weider Publishing Industry</h3>
<p>Joe Weider believed that there were others out there like him who wanted to feel good about their bodies and were willing to work to get there. In 1939 the age of seventeen he took his last seven dollars and started a small magazine called “Your Physique”. This twelve-page publication discussed weightlifting, bodybuilding and nutritional issues and sold for two dollars for a yearly subscription. It became a hit with fitness enthusiasts and weightlifters alike and was soon sold across Canada. The magazine, and the Weider brothers, never looked back.</p>

<h3>Weider Achievements</h3>
<p>In 1945 Ben and Joe Weider began a mail order fitness equipment business called Weider Sports Equipment Limited and Weider Health and Fitness in both Canada and the United States. They quickly found that there was genuine interest in weightlifting and bodybuilding although many people did not yet see it as a sport. Joe and Ben Weider began to establish reputable competitions for body builders and other fitness conscious people to compete. They used a panel of judges to decide not only strength but also overall muscle development and conformation. The Weiders continued on with this tradition fostering the following competitions and organizations:</p>
<ul>
<li>1946 – Started the International Federation of Bodybuilding and Fitness (IBFF). Currently there are 176 member countries.</li>
<li>1946 – Organized the first Mr. Canada</li>
<li>1949 – Ben Weider travels to Europe to promote bodybuilding</li>
<li>1965 – Organized the first Mr. Olympia contest</li>
<li>1980 – Facilitated the first Ms. Olympia contest</li>
</ul>
<p>The Weider’s are some of the first fitness trainers and event promoters to work with females and minorities in competitions. They truly did and still do encourage all people to incorporate fitness and weightlifting as part of an overall approach to a healthy lifestyle.</p>

<p>Joe and Ben Weider did not just stop at promoting the sport and producing equipment, they also worked towards having bodybuilding recognized as a sport. They finally accomplished that in 1998 when the International Olympic Committee officially recognized the IBFF, fifty-two years after it was founded.</p>

<h3>Jillian Michaels Mini Bio</h3>
<p>Jillian Michaels became interested in exercise and fitness after enrolling in a martial arts class as teenager. She had weight problems as a child and her mother encouraged her to start martial arts as a means to get fit. This led to her developing a career in fitness, becoming a personal fitness instructor, and then a TV fitness instructor on the weight loss show <em>The Biggest Loser</em>. She still uses elements from her martial arts training in her fitness routines, plus bodyweight strength training, yoga, Pilates, plyometrics, and weight training.</p>
